The Itinerary in Detail: What You Can Expect

Jallianwala Bagh: A Site of Reflection and History

Your journey begins at Jallianwala Bagh, a poignant reminder of colonial history. This site is marked by a memorial and a museum, but the real impact comes from standing on the ground where the 1919 massacre took place. The guide will briefly introduce the event, giving context to why this place is so vital to Indian consciousness.
As one reviewer mentioned, being there “was a moment of reflection,” and having a guide explain the significance helps deepen the experience. Since admission is free, it’s a welcoming start that sets the tone for understanding Amritsar’s turbulent past.

Heritage Street: Walking into Amritsar’s Soul

Walking from Jallianwala Bagh towards the Golden Temple, you’ll pass through Heritage Street, where your guide shares stories about Amritsar’s evolution and the roots of Sikhism in the city. Expect to hear about local life and the city’s cultural tapestry, making the walk more than just a transition but a step into the local fabric.
This segment is brief—around 10 minutes—but adds valuable context especially for first-time visitors unfamiliar with the city’s story.

Central Sikh Museum: Art and Philosophy

Next, you visit the Central Sikh Museum, where paintings and artifacts illustrate Sikh history and philosophy. As one reviewer pointed out, it’s an excellent way to understand Sikhism’s teachings through visual storytelling. Expect to see historical portraits and religious symbols that deepen your appreciation for the faith’s resilience and values.

Dukh Bhanjani Ber Tree: A Spot of Healing

The tour includes a stop at the Dukh Bhanjani Ber Tree, famous for its believed healing powers and the holy dips taken in nearby Amrit Sarovar. This site offers a spiritual break, where you can learn about the significance of Dukh Bhanjani Ber in Sikh tradition.
Many find this stop peaceful, and it adds a layer of spiritual reflection to the tour.

Golden Temple: The Heart of Sikh Spirituality

The main highlight, of course, is the Golden Temple itself. Your guide takes you through the complex, explaining the architecture and the symbolism behind its stunning gold facade.
Here, you’ll witness the Langar, the communal kitchen serving free meals to thousands daily. Several reviews highlight the backstage access to the kitchen, which allows a rare glimpse into how the community sustains this massive operation. Expect to see volunteers working, food being prepared, and an atmosphere filled with devotion and service.
You’ll also learn about the temple’s spiritual ambiance—music, Gurbani recitations, and the sense of peace that envelops visitors.

Architectural Fascination and Fun Facts

Following the spiritual tour, you’ll get a detailed explanation of the Golden Temple’s architecture and some intriguing facts. This part of the experience appeals to those interested in design and history, enriching the visit beyond the visual splendor.

Baba Deep Singh Gurdwara and Akal Takht

Passing through the Baba Deep Singh Gurdwara, dedicated to a revered Sikh warrior, offers a glimpse into the martial history of Sikhism. The tour concludes with a visit to Akal Takht, a significant religious and political seat in Sikhism, where your guide will clarify its importance.

Practical Details: What You Should Know

Golden Temple and Jallianwala Bagh Guided Tour - Practical Details: What You Should Know

  • The tour lasts approximately 2.5 hours, making it ideal for a morning or early afternoon activity.
  • It begins at Jallianwala Bagh and ends back at the starting point, streamlining logistics.
  • No transportation is included, so consider local arrangements if you’re staying far from the meeting point.
  • The tour is suitable for most travelers, with confirmed participation from diverse ages and backgrounds.
  • The group size is limited to ensure a personalized experience, which many reviewers appreciated.
  • Remember to wear clothes covering knees and shoulders to enter the Golden Temple respectfully.
